Rule 12-15 -- Summary of Investments--Other than Investments in Related Parties


[For insurance companies]


     Column A                       Column B     Column C      Column D
     --------                       --------     --------      --------
                                                             Amount at which
    Type of Investment                Cost 1      Value       shown on the
                                                             balance sheet 2

Fixed maturities: Bonds: United States Government and government agencies and author- ities States, municipalities and political subdivisions Foreign governments Public utilities Convertibles and bonds with warrants attached 3 All other corporate bonds Certificates of deposit Redeemable preferred stock __________ __________ ___________ Total fixed maturities __________ __________ ___________ Equity securities: Common stocks Public utilities Banks, trust and insur- ance companies Industrial, miscellaneous and all other Nonredeemable preferred stocks __________ __________ ___________ Total equity securities __________ __________ ___________ Mortgage loans on real estate xxxxxx Real estate 4 xxxxxx Policy loans xxxxxx Other long-term investments xxxxxx Short-term investments __________ xxxxxx ___________ Total investments __________ xxxxxx ___________

    1. Original cost of equity securities and, as to fixed maturities, original cost reduced by repayments and adjusted for amortization of premiums or accrual of discounts.


    2. If the amount at which shown in the balance sheet is different from the amount. shown in either column B or C, state the reason for such difference. The total of this column should agree with the balance sheet.


    3. All convertibles and bonds with warrants shall be included in this caption, regardless of issuer.


    4. State separately any real estate acquired in satisfaction of debt.
